Facts on Spring 2019 Commencement

Facts on Spring 2019 Commencement

The Ohio State University

Sunday, May 5, 2019

Noon, Ohio Stadium

 

Number of degrees and certificates

Doctoral             294

Professional       811

Masters            1,913

Bachelors       8,449

Associates         663

Certificates          83

Total:              12,213

 

WELCOMING REMARKS: Javaune Adams-Gaston, senior vice president for student life

PRESIDING OFFICER: President Michael V. Drake

COMMENCEMENT SPEAKER: Fareed Zakaria, host of Fareed Zakaria GPS (Global Public Square) for CNN Worldwide and columnist for The Washington Post

STUDENT SPEAKERS: Nick Frankowski, a native of Cincinnati and candidate for the bachelor of science in economics; and Melissa Martinez-Cuen, a native of Paulding and candidate for the bachelor of science in early childhood education

HONORARY DEGREES: The university awarded the honorary Doctor of Humane Letters degree to Fareed Zakaria, the commencement speaker

DISTINGUISHED SERVICE AWARDS: Distinguished Service Awards were presented to George W. Acock (BS ’63, architecture), founder and president of Acock Associates Architects and credited with the renovations of Pomerene Hall, Thompson Library and Sullivant Hall; Linda Kass (MA ’78), former university trustee, author and owner of Gramercy Books in Bexley; and William T. “Ted” McDaniel Jr., professor emeritus of music and African American and African Studies and specialist in jazz history, jazz performance and African American music

NATIONAL ANTHEM and CARMEN OHIO: Dylan M. Davis, candidate, master of music

ABOUT THE GRADUATING CLASS:

  • The 2019 graduating class size is the largest in university history for the fifth consecutive year, surpassing previous records of 11,907 in 2018,11,734 in 2017, 11,235 in 2016 and 11,040 in 2015.
